summ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orLars Wirzenius <liw@liw.fi>2021-08-20 17:23:12 +0300
committerLars Wirzenius <liw@liw.fi>2021-08-20 17:23:12 +0300
commit70506e844ea26138494f59bfc3ecec88f2464491 (patch)
tree75b207b7da4353035ff5328510d7a943185d5c52 /src
parent3b9f7397d4116ae6f661a3d0aaf9f92937775510 (diff)
downloadvmadm-70506e844ea26138494f59bfc3ecec88f2464491.tar.gz
feat! add support for non-virtual networks
The virtual, libvirt-only network foo must now be specified as network=foo, to allow a non-virtual network over a local bridge device be specified as bridge=br0. Sponsored-by: author
Diffstat (limited to 'src')
-rw-r--r--src/config.rs2
-rw-r--r--src/install.rs2
2 files changed, 2 insertions, 2 deletions
diff --git a/src/config.rs b/src/config.rs
index 50b94b0..6829151 100644
--- a/src/config.rs
+++ b/src/config.rs
@@ -74,7 +74,7 @@ impl Configuration {
fn fill_in_missing_networks(&mut self) {
if self.default_networks.is_none() {
- self.default_networks = Some(vec!["default".to_string()]);
+ self.default_networks = Some(vec!["network=default".to_string()]);
}
}
diff --git a/src/install.rs b/src/install.rs
index 17b7be8..4738855 100644
--- a/src/install.rs
+++ b/src/install.rs
@@ -111,7 +111,7 @@ pub fn virt_install(args: &VirtInstallArgs, iso: &Path) -> Result<PathBuf, VirtI
let networks: Vec<String> = args
.networks
.iter()
- .map(|s| format!("--network=network={}", s))
+ .map(|s| format!("--network={}", s))
.collect();
args.init().create_iso(iso)?;